Job summary

Cotswold House Specialist Eating Disorder Unit and the Wiltshire Community ED Team are seeking an enthusiastic Dietitian to join their busy Multidisciplinary Team.

With a reputation for excellence, our service provides a stepped model of care tailored to the individual's needs for stabilisation and recovery. We offer a range of programmes and evidence-based treatments to assist a patient's return to independent living

The successful candidate/s will join our team providing specialist nutritional knowledge, dietary assessments and education to service users with eating disorders that have been referred to the Team

They will provide a key role within the multidisciplinary team and support the delivery of the group programme as well as provide support and advice to other professionals and members of the team.

Main duties of the job

The successful candidate will be able to provide dietetic advice to adults with diagnosed eating disorder individually and in groups as well as providing nutrition assessments and care plans.

Contribute to the development and implementation of clinical standards, policies, and procedures for the service, training students and health care professionals in specified areas of nutrition and dietetics.

Lead on specific clinical audit projects and contribute to research to inform clinical governance strategy, service development and evidence-based practice.

Educate, train and disseminate information to all healthcare professionals providing nutritional advice for patients.

Participate in the trust wide nutrition and hydration steering group

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
